2. Key Details at a Glance

ItemDetails
Recruiting BodyGujarat Police Recruitment Board (GPRB)
Total Vacancies949
PostsPSI (Wireless), PSI (Motor Transport), Technical Operator, Head Constable (Driver Mechanic)
Job LocationGujarat
Application ModeOnline
Application Window09 January 2026 to 29 January 2026
SelectionWritten Exam + Physical/Medical + Document Verification
Pay (Fixed for 5 Years)₹26,000 to ₹49,600 per month

3. Post-Wise Eligibility - What It Means in Practice

PSI (Wireless) & Technical Operator

Who this is really for: These posts are designed for candidates with strong fundamentals in Electronics, Communication, IT, or Computer Engineering. The written exam heavily tests technical subjects-this is not a formality.

Apply if:

  • You have actually studied subjects like Digital Electronics, Networks, Communication Systems
  • You are comfortable revising engineering concepts, not just GK
  • You want a desk + field hybrid technical role

Avoid if:

  • You chose engineering “by chance” and never built subject clarity
  • You are purely preparing for non-technical exams like SSC CGL

PSI (Motor Transport)

Who this suits best: Mechanical or Automobile engineers who understand vehicle systems, maintenance, and logistics. This role involves fleet management, inspections, and technical supervision.

Key reality check: You must hold a Heavy Vehicle Driving License. Many candidates ignore this and get rejected later.


Head Constable (Driver Mechanic)

Ideal for: Diploma holders who want entry into the police force through a skill-based route, not purely academic competition.

Important: This is a physically demanding role with real field responsibility. It offers dignity and stability but is not a soft posting.


4. How to Apply - Guided Walkthrough with Mistakes to Avoid

  1. Apply only through the OJAS portal used by Gujarat Government.
  2. Complete One Time Registration carefully-name, DOB, category must exactly match certificates.
  3. Select the correct post. Many candidates mistakenly apply for PSI instead of Technical Operator.
  4. Upload photograph and signature strictly within size limits.
  5. Confirm the application and save the confirmation number-this is often lost and causes panic later.
  6. Pay the fee if applicable. Reserved category candidates should still complete the confirmation step.

Common mistake: Candidates fill the form correctly but forget to click final confirmation. An unconfirmed form is treated as invalid.


5. Salary, Growth & Career Outlook (Often Ignored, But Crucial)

Yes, the salary is fixed for five years, which worries some aspirants. Here is the practical view:

  • Fixed pay ensures income stability from day one
  • After five years, candidates move to regular pay scale with DA, HRA, NPS
  • PSI-level posts carry promotion pathways to Inspector and higher technical supervisory roles
  • Police technical cadres face less frequent transfers compared to general duty police

This is not a quick-money job. It is a long-term service career.
